Notes for ELIJAH DUNAGAN:

In 1850 was a cabinet maker in the Crisman Chair Factory in Gosport, Indiana while he was boarding with the Chrisman family. . There was a lot of business in the 1850's and 1860's for anyone who could prepare wagons and horses for the wagon trains west. His brothers did blacksmithing work. May have also been a minister. Made several trips to Gentry County, Missouri, possibly as a wagon master. Was a member of the Masons in 1864 in Gentry County and lived next door to his brother, Thomas, in 1864 in Gentryville, MO. At the Masonic Lodge, in Gentry County, Missouri they had to check their guns at the door before going to the meeting hall on the second floor above the Gentryville Baptist Church. There are letters that were written by Elijah to his brother Solomon in the possession of Richard Dunagan in Wisconsin.

Notes for FRANKLIN GARRISON:

Considered a pioneer of the state of Indiana; came to Owen County in 1825 and removed to Morgan County in 1829. Entered a Land Patent dated 12/29/1834 for 40 acres in Morgan County, IN, Twp 13, 1 W, 30, (Gregg Twp. sw qtr of se qtr. Nearest neighbor was John Craven (11/21/1836). Sold 40 acres in Jefferson Twp. to his brother-in-law, Thomas Norris, 8/4/1847, for $125.

Built 20 large flatboats used for transporting produce to New Orleans.

In October, 1870, his sawmill in Ashland Township burned down.

On 3/16/1871, J. F. Layman won a judgement by default against F. Garrison etal for $62.59.

Notes for WILLIAM GREEN GARRISON:

Following excerpt taken from "COUNTIES OF MORGAN, MONROE AND BROWN, INDIANA", 1884:

William G. Garrison, a native of Gregg Township, Morgan County, Indiana, was born December 25, 1840. His parents, William and Phebe (Norris) Garrison, natives of Kentucky, were married in 1840 in Morgan County, Indiana and located in Gregg Township, where they continued to live until 1848, when they removed to a farm in Jefferson Township. There in 1852, the mother died. The father is at present living in Warren County, Iowa. William G. Garrison is the eldest of five children, and was reared in Gregg and Jefferson Townships until April, 1861. He enlisted in Comp. K, 7th Indiana Volunteers under Captain Jeff K. Scott, in the three months service. His company immediately went into active service, and he took part in battles of Philippi, Cheatam Mountain, Garricks Ford, etc. He was mustered out on 8-3-1861, and in July, 1862, he re-enlisted in Co. H., 70th Indiana volunteers under Captain A.D. Canning. He served until 6-19-1865 and took part in the battles of Russellville, Resaca, Peach Tree Creek, Atlanta, Savannah, Averysboro and Bentonville. During Sherman's March to sea, he was considered an expert forager and some of his narrow escapes on various expeditions are interesting in the extreme. In March, 1862, he was married to Sarah Winter, daughter of George and Mary Winter, pioneers of Morgan County. After his return from the war, in 1866, he followed his trade as stationary engineer until July 1872, when he was severely attacked with acute rheumatism in his right leg, which made him incapable of labor. In October 1876 he was elected as Recorder of Morgan County on the Republican ticket, and four years later was re-elected to the same office, in the discharge of which duties he is at present engaged. He is a member of the G. A. R. His wife is an active and faithful member of the Christian Church. They have eight children-Orestes, Harriet E., Thomas O. (deceased), May, Luther, Dot, Annie (deceased) and Perry.
